The research of AOS standard has become more and more important with the standard data of AOS adopted in international space technology step by step. As the basic instrument in transmitting AOS data is under slow construction, the further study about AOS is hindered seriously. Therefore, it is significant to develop AOS synchronous receiver for both the researches into the AOS standard and our country's space technology. The paper achieves AOS Synchronous Receiver, the basic instrument of AOS.Centered on CY7C68013A, the design makes it achievable for the receiver, through programming firmware of chip, to receive data, check the synchronization marker, protect the synchronous state and implement FIFO, which succeed in receiving data of AOS and passing it on to host by USB. Also, the functions of transmitter and receive are integrated to one card so that the system will keep on monitoring data from transmitter after loading firmware automatically. The results of subject are that the transceiver can receive the transmitted data intact by itself, that the system can realize consistence with the PC plug-and-play architecture and that one transceiver can receive data from another at the rate of 20kbps with few errors.In conclusion, it is possible to adopt frame synchronization and synchronization protection in AOS, and it is flexible to make use of USB interface in the communication between Receiver and PC.Now, AOS synchronization transceiver's rate is not satisfying, but will make great progress by improving the design proposal and its hardware. The design is the first development in the basic instrument of AOS, also making first-phase preparations for Hardware synchronization receiver. |
